![]() ![]() Dog Health Concerns![]() ![]() AmyloidosisDescription: Abnormal deposition of amyloid protection in vital organs and tissues interferes in the normal functions of the organ. The most common form of the disease is Renal Amyloidosis that affects the kidneys. Typically, it is a hereditary condition however chronic infections may also cause Renal Amyloidosis. The clinical signs of the disease include excessive thirst and urination, weight loss, and swelling in the limbs. Diagnosis is best carried out by conducting a biopsy. Treatment is directed at reducing or altogether stopping the synthesis of amyloid protein as well as treating of any symptoms brought about by the disease. Breeds Commonly Affected: There are three breeds of dog prone to Amyloidosis---Beagle, Shar Pei, and Collie. ![]() ![]() |
